About the speaker: Liesbeth Simons is the Project Manager for the subsidy scheme ‘Geld voor je kunst!’ and Advisor for Cultural Engagement at CultuurSchakel, an organization that supports and promotes cultural activities for all residents in The Hague. CultuurSchakel offers funding, guidance, and networking opportunities. They aim to make culture accessible and engaging, fostering a vibrant and inclusive cultural community.
